[ ] Validator plugins: make sure every third-party validator in Sievekit loads from the plugins directory and passes the smoke suite. New folks — a validator that fails to register just gets skipped silently, so check the startup log count matches the manifest. If the numbers line up, you're good; note the build token shown below.

pipeline stamp: htk9_ce63042d9

Ticket #2291 — Rip out the homegrown job queue

So, the hand-rolled queue in Dovetail's worker service has bitten us again: duplicate job execution after a restart because the in-memory lease table isn't persisted. Plan is to swap it for Queuewright, which gives us visibility timeouts and dead-lettering for free. Migration notes and a compat shim live in the dovetail-queue-migration branch. Future maintainers: don't extend the old queue, just finish this. Reference build below.

trace token, kahog-tajeg: htk6_97d963

Ticket: Drift on Pathfinder tile prefetcher. Prod fleet no longer matches the committed baseline — someone hand-edited concurrency and cache TTLs during last month's incident and never backported. New folks: never edit live configs directly; change the repo, let Driftwatch roll it out. Fix is to reconcile prod against baseline this week. Current live values on the prod fleet are captured below for comparison.

deployment values, yafop-tahof:
HOLIX_HOST=holix.zemvarsys.internal
HOLIX_PORT=3306

// Catalogue import ceiling for the Westerholt Library feed.
// Support: if patrons report missing titles, the import likely
// hit this cap and truncated the batch. Raise only after the
// Ferncliff ingest team confirms shard capacity; do not patch
// in production. The constant below was validated against the
// build identified on the following line.

session token of hawif-bajog = htk6_9ab8da